Who is UX Brighton aimed at?

You don’t need to be a “UX designer” to attend UX Brighton.

We aim our events at designers, developers, project managers, entrepreneurs, copywriters and basically anyone who thinks that listening to users makes them better at their job.

About UX Brighton

UX Brighton is a community group disseminating knowledge about all aspects of user experience, founded in 2008 by Danny Hope.

Our evening events happen on the 2nd tuesday of the month in central Brighton and we also run an annual conference, usually in November.

We’re experimenting with running special in-depth workshops.

Team

Photo of Danny

Danny HopeFounder

Danny is a User Experience consultant and the founder of UX Brighton. He curates the annual UX Brighton conference. Danny is also the cofounder of JS Bin, a tool for experimenting with web languages.

Annie-Marie PageConference Producer

Annie-Marie has been the conference producer since 2019, pulling together the myriad strands to ensure the conference runs like clockwork. She also manages the mentorship program, monthly evening events and workshops. She loves connecting with the community.

Luke HayOrganiser

Luke is a Senior Conversion Strategist at Fresh Egg and a freelance UX and Analytics consultant and trainer. He's been involved with UX Brighton for a couple of years and is also a co-organiser of UX Camp Brighton.

Alex GoluszkoOrganiser

Alex is a designer and user experience practitioner with a keen interest in novel UIs and a passion for diversity in technology and design. She's been curating UX Brighton events since 2012, covering mobile user testing, healthcare UX and the Internet of Things.

Patrick SansomOrganiser

Patrick founded UX Camp Brighton in 2011 and has run the event for the last three years. Currently working as a Digital Consultant at Brilliant Noise, focusing on UX strategy and delivery.

Harry BrignullOrganiser

Harry is an independent user experience consultant who blogs at 90percentofeverything.com and curates Darkpatterns.org — a site dedicated to understanding deceptive user interfaces, with the aim of stamping them out and improving the web for everyone.
